byo-proxy — bring-your-own residential proxy

Users supply their own residential proxy account (currently IPRoyal); this skill stores the credentials in the workspace .env, maintains a skill → provider/country binding table, and exposes a tiny Python API that other skills can opt into.

This skill does not run a proxy server and does not intercept any traffic. It is a configuration center plus a URL builder. Other skills only behave differently if they explicitly import from exports.py.

Boundaries vs. existing proxy skills

Skill What it does When
sc-vpn Internal VPN gateway, 18 fixed countries, no auth Last resort for geo-blocked requests inside Starchild
transparent-proxy-maintenance Maintain the platform's billing proxy plugins Ops work on sc-proxy
byo-proxy (this) Manage user's own residential provider keys + per-skill bindings User wants residential IPs, paid accounts, country granularity beyond sc-vpn's 18

Supported providers

Provider Status Endpoint Auth
IPRoyal ✅ supported geo.iproyal.com:12321 username + password

Adding more providers later: drop a new providers/<name>.py adapter and update PROVIDERS in exports.py. See references/iproyal.md for the IPRoyal username parameter format.

Storage

  • Credentials/data/workspace/.env (same convention as polymarket, birdeye, coingecko). Keys: IPROYAL_USERNAME, IPROYAL_PASSWORD.
  • Bindings + provider metadata/data/workspace/.byo-proxy.json. Edited only through scripts; agents should not hand-edit.

User workflow

SKILL=/data/workspace/skills/byo-proxy

# 0. One-shot onboarding (recommended for first-time setup) — does 1+3+5 in sequence:
#    prompts for credentials only if missing, creates the binding, runs a live test.
python3 $SKILL/scripts/onboard.py web-crawler --provider iproyal --country jp

# 1. Register a provider (interactive — prompts for username/password)
python3 $SKILL/scripts/setup_provider.py iproyal

# 2. List configured providers + bindings
python3 $SKILL/scripts/list_providers.py

# 3. Bind a skill to a provider/country (long-term preference)
python3 $SKILL/scripts/bind_skill.py web-crawler --provider iproyal --country jp
python3 $SKILL/scripts/bind_skill.py web-crawler --provider iproyal --country jp --sticky 30   # 30-min sticky session

# 4. Unbind
python3 $SKILL/scripts/bind_skill.py web-crawler --unset

# 5. Verify exit IP/country actually works
python3 $SKILL/scripts/test_proxy.py iproyal --country jp

How other skills consume it

Two patterns. Both raise ProxyNotConfiguredError on misconfiguration — never silent fallback (a residential-proxy user is debugging a geo problem; silently falling through to direct connection makes that debugging much harder).

Pattern A — explicit, one-off

Use when a skill needs a specific country for a specific request:

import sys, requests
sys.path.insert(0, "/data/workspace/skills/byo-proxy")
from exports import get_proxy_url

p = get_proxy_url(provider="iproyal", country="jp")
r = requests.get("https://example.com", proxies={"http": p, "https": p}, timeout=30)

Pattern B — bound, long-term

Use when a skill always wants to route through whatever the user configured for it:

import sys, requests
sys.path.insert(0, "/data/workspace/skills/byo-proxy")
from exports import get_proxy_for_skill, ProxyNotConfiguredError

try:
    p = get_proxy_for_skill("web-crawler")   # caller declares its own name
except ProxyNotConfiguredError as e:
    # The exception message IS a multi-line onboarding guide for the user —
    # surface it verbatim. It includes the signup URL, pricing note, and the
    # one-shot `onboard.py` command to fix the situation.
    raise SystemExit(str(e))

r = requests.get(url, proxies={"http": p, "https": p}, timeout=30)

A skill that does not import get_proxy_for_skill() is unaffected, even if the user has bindings configured. Opt-in only.

Onboarding for unconfigured skills

When get_proxy_for_skill("X") raises because nothing is configured for X, the exception message is already a complete onboarding script: signup URL, pricing, credential location, and the exact onboard.py command to run. Agents that surface this error to a user will naturally walk them through registration and binding — no extra logic needed in the calling skill.

If a calling skill wants to render its own onboarding UI (instead of relying on the error message), it can import the same text directly:

from exports import onboarding_guide
print(onboarding_guide("web-crawler", provider="iproyal", country="jp"))

Public API (exports.py)

Function Returns Raises
get_proxy_url(provider, country, sticky_minutes=None, session=None) str proxy URL ProxyNotConfiguredError if creds missing or country invalid
get_proxy_for_skill(skill_name) str proxy URL ProxyNotConfiguredError (multi-line onboarding guide) if no binding, binding's provider has no creds, or country invalid
onboarding_guide(skill_name, provider="iproyal", country="<cc>") str onboarding text (signup URL, pricing, command) ValueError on bad provider
list_providers() list[dict]{provider, configured, default_country, bound_skills} never
set_binding(skill_name, provider, country, sticky_minutes=None) None ValueError on bad provider/country
unset_binding(skill_name) None never
test_proxy(provider, country) dict{ok, exit_ip, geo_country, latency_ms} ProxyNotConfiguredError

Per-request only — no global proxy

Same rule as sc-vpn: never export HTTP_PROXY=... from this skill's URLs. Pass proxies= to the specific request only. Setting global env vars will break unrelated skills (notably sc-proxy traffic for paid APIs).

Troubleshooting

Error Cause Fix
ProxyNotConfiguredError: Skill 'X' has no proxy binding bindings.json has no entry for X one-shot: python3 scripts/onboard.py X --provider iproyal --country <cc>
ProxyNotConfiguredError: ...USERNAME / ...PASSWORD not found provider creds were never saved (or removed from .env) python3 scripts/setup_provider.py iproyal (or re-run onboard.py)
ProxyNotConfiguredError: ... bound to unknown provider bindings.json references a provider that no longer exists python3 scripts/bind_skill.py X --unset then rebind
ValueError: Unknown country code 'XX' not in IPRoyal's supported list see references/iproyal.md for valid codes
test_proxy returns ok=false wrong creds, expired account, network log into IPRoyal dashboard, check balance / re-register

Files

byo-proxy/
├── SKILL.md
├── exports.py                # public API for other skills
├── scripts/
│   ├── onboard.py            # one-shot: setup creds (if needed) + bind + test
│   ├── setup_provider.py     # interactive credential setup
│   ├── list_providers.py     # show configured providers + bindings
│   ├── bind_skill.py         # set/unset skill→provider/country binding
│   └── test_proxy.py         # verify exit IP via ifconfig.co
└── references/
    └── iproyal.md            # IPRoyal-specific endpoint + parameter docs
